What's recognized as the "going and coming regulation" indicates that regular day travel, driving to and from the work environment, is not covered by workers' compensation in most states. If an accident takes place during such traveling and an employee is harmed, he or she would not be made up for those injuries.
This consists of employees running a duty for their company, like quiting by the article office, dropping off paperwork with a customer or picking up a cake for a firm party, unless the staff member drifted for their very own duty or benefit. The most typical locations for staff member injuries outside the workplace are pathways, walkways and car park.
Employees' payment will certainly cover injuries that occur within the course and extent of work. If a staff member is wounded outside the training course and scope of their employement and is incapable to function while they recover, they may be qualified for Household Medical Leave Act (12 weeks of overdue leave), short-term impairment or long-term handicap.

For lots of Americans, driving commercial trucks, vehicles and vans is a routine and essential part of their work. These hardworking males and females go to greater danger of suffering a serious injury or being eliminated in an automobile crash. Job-related vehicle accidents aren't just an issue for truck drivers, bus operators, delivery motorists and cabby.
Over half (55 percent) of employees that passed away in 2017 were not employed in car operator tasks. Industries with the highest possible car collision rates include transport and warehousing, building, wholesale and retail trade in addition to farming and forestry. Just like all work environment injuries and crashes, crashes and accidents that happen while an employee is "on the clock" are generally covered by employees' payment.

Because a lot of mishaps and injuries take place at the work environment or while an individual is acting upon behalf of their employer, the concern often occurs regarding the difference between a workers settlement and an injury case under The golden state law.
If an employee endures an "commercial injury", he or she may be qualified to obtain advantages for that injury or injuries through the California workers settlement system. An "commercial injury" is an injury sustained during the course and scope of their employment (i.e. while doing a job for their company or at their employer's instructions).

The majority of employers in South Carolina are accountable for covering the medical expenses of their employees that are hurt in job-related crashes.
The general guideline with occupational car mishaps is that your company has to cover your medical expenses after a collision unless you were driving to or from job. This principle is known as the Going and Coming Guideline. This means you usually can not assert employees' payment advantages if the auto mishap took place throughout your daily commute to or from your work.
As long as the mishap took place on business home or as component of a work-related task, you should qualify for employees' compensation benefits. Any medical expenses connected to your injuries in an auto crash while at work must be completely covered by employees' compensation. If you miss out on job as a result of your injuries, the workers' compensation wage-replacement advantages will hide to two-thirds of your typical weekly earnings, as set by state legislation.
Independent specialists (but understand that many employers attempt to incorrectly identify staff members as independent contractors) Casual employees Agricultural laborer Railway workers Federal civil servant operating in the state Some owner-operator vehicle chauffeurs In South Carolina, workers' compensation is a no-fault benefit. This implies that it does not matter who triggered the car mishap, as long as it took place during an occupational task or on firm property.

Effective October 1, 2012, claims for workers' compensation should be submitted electronically making use of the Employees' Settlement Operations and Monitoring Website (ECOMP).
You will begin by signing up with the ECOMP website: . Workers are needed to register and produce an ECOMP account. You need to likewise call your Employees' Settlement Expert for guidance before getting going with ECOMP. You must report all work-related problems to your manager and file the Kind CA-1 or Form CA-2, even if there is no lost time or medical expenditure.
In many circumstances, a few of the blocks on Forms CA-1 and CA-2 will certainly not relate to your scenario. As opposed to leave them blank (which will lead to them being gone back to you and delaying your claim), suggest not applicable or "N/A". All files significant to your workers' payment need to be online published and submitted throughout the ECOMP initiation of the claim.
